> System tasks should run without any explicitly granted permissions
> ------------------------------------------------------------------

> For example, this code needs TASK_EXECUTE permissions.
> {code:java}
> Affinity affinity = ignite.affinity("TEST");
> affinity.mapKeysToNodes(Arrays.asList(1L,100L, 1000L));{code}
> This is unexpected behavior, because:
>  - the task started implicitly (under the hood), customer should not to know 
> about it.
>  - this is a system task (not defined by a customer), the tasks needs for a 
> normal grid workflow.
> Also, I suppose there are any other implicitly tasks, which could lead to 
> unexpected behavior (need permissions).
